The Halo's Secret Weapon
The construction and mindset of Major League Baseball teams has changed since the implementation of the play-in wild-card game five years ago. More teams are in the mix. A club can hover around .500 for much of the season and still consider themselves playoff contenders. Front offices who realize their team is likely to compete in the play-in game can build their rosters to leverage themselves in the potential winner take-all match-up.

The Arrival of Paul George Still Doesn't Make OKC Contenders
When Sam Presti pried four-time All-Star Paul George away from the Oklahoma City Thunder this offseason, people immediately moved the Thunder up the standings and called them contenders. We all throw around the word “contender” on a regular basis, as if there’s some sort of locked-in definition to what it means in the NBA. There is no recipe or equation that can prove if you’re a legitimate contender, and not even a Charles Barkley rambling anecdote about contending back in his day can give you the answer you’re looking for. We may not be able to reach an agreement on an exact Webster’s Dictionary definition of what a contender is, but hopefully we can all agree that despite the addition of Paul George, OKC is not.
